Job Details

The mission of the role is to transform the Aristocrat Design and Development Finance team to become genuine business partners to the Gaming Design and Development teams. Recent efficiency moves have streamlined internal reporting and instituted a nimble, key driver-based approach to planning and forecasting. An opportunity exists to activate genuine business partnerships further by aligning key team members even closer to their cross-functional business partners and commercial teams. The candidate will have a strong change orientation, strong leadership skills, and be able to guide the use of data.

The company’s biggest asset is our Design and Development talent. This role will be a strategic partner to the group's key leaders, ensure core financial processes for D&D are established, and provide reporting, analysis, forecasting, and budgeting support to D&D and Global marketing across all departments.

The role is both strategic and operational where the key outcomes are to continue to make the budgeting and planning process key driver-based, balancing the continuous flow of risks and opportunities. Maintain a multi-year financial forecast that interlocks the commercial priorities with a 3-year product development roadmap. Manage the portfolio to deliver expense-to-revenue targets. Partner with key stakeholders in the estimation of D&D expense for Gaming business cases and ensure alternative assumptions are identified. Work cross functionally to determine when key assumptions have changed, and further leadership dialogue is needed. Generate accurate and timely insights and trends on D&D spend and the related value generated. Use data visualization tools to create dashboards to optimize understanding for non-financial creative leaders. Participate in a community of practice for D&D finance across the company, collaborating with Group Finance, Aristocrat Interactive, Pixel United, and Corporate Strategy as appropriate. . Ensure data governance is well maintained. Ensure proper accounting rules are followed for capitalization of intangible assets, that capex is well controlled and balance sheet reconciliations are conducted monthly.

The outlook of the role is primarily internal, with the Chief Product Officer, Gaming, and his leadership team as the primary business partners. The role will guide senior leaders in the Design and Development community to prioritize their resources, identify choices, and optimize their spending. Will collaborate with Commercial Finance, the Reporting Center of Excellence, Corporate Finance, and other Finance functional resources to deploy financial systems and processes within Aristocrat to meet business unit performance targets. The role communicates with and utilizes the resources and support available within Aristocrat in Tax, Treasury, Accounting Services, D&D Project Management, and the broader Gaming D&D Senior Management Team.

What You'll Do

  • Responsible for Global Gaming Design and Development Spend across multiple time horizons:  three-year roadmap, annual plan, LEs, and monthly actuals.
  • Monitor spending by strategic investments, named functions, and by key leaders.  Maintain performance dashboards and ROI models that monitor these investments.  Foster the need for continuous improvement. 
  • Continue to drive collaboration with Commercial / Commercial Finance to increase execution excellence. 
  • Collaborate with Global HR to ensure our headcount and people costs are well understood.
  • Responsible for all Global Gaming D&D analysis to Senior Management and Group Finance.  Includes any additional half-year and Year End reporting.  The provision of insightful and timely information to Senior D&D Management is a critical responsibility of this role.
  • Partner with Gaming D&D stakeholders on planned and forecasted spend
  • Collaborate to ensure Game Title data integrity, guiding the data analyst in India to achieve.
  • Prepare and distribute the Studio Bang-for-Buck reporting package on a quarterly.
  • Oversee the calculation process for studio incentives and track studio profitability.
  • Manage the reconciliation of balance sheet liabilities for incentive programs.
  • Responsible for internal controls over Gaming D&D Finance.  Includes liaising and coordinating with Group Risk & Audit on any internal audit assignments as well as measurement & monitoring of audit recommendations to ensure commitments are actioned.
  • Ensure investment decisions are strategically sound throughout their investment life-cycle:
    • Business case D&D investments including identification of alternatives
    • Work closely with:
      • Product management (hardware, software, Class III, Class II) to assess requirements and timing of investment spending.
      • Content studios to understand standard game costs, develop studio performance dashboards, and provide game title trends and insights.
      • Commercial Finance teams to ensure the entire P&L picture (i.e. revenue and costs) is collated, monitored, and tracked on all projects. 
      • Project governance team and relevant project and program managers on the above to ensure accurate and timely tracking of costs and schedules
  • Led an extended team of three.  Two direct reports:  Financial Manager FP&A with a Financial Analyst direct report and a Finance Data Analyst in India.  There is also a collaboration relationship with the India Finance Director, who has two Financial Managers directly supporting D&D, the Gaming RCOE, and Commercial Finance supporting the GIC.
  • Any other ad hoc projects as they arise.

About The Company

Aristocrat Leisure Limited (ASX: ALL) is a leading gaming content creation company powered by technology to deliver industry-leading casino games together with mobile games and online real money games, collectively entertaining millions of players worldwide, every day. Headquartered in Sydney, Australia, Aristocrat has three operating business units, spanning regulated land-based gaming (Aristocrat Gaming),social casino (Product Madness)and regulated online real money (Aristocrat Interactive).
